predate - Dictionary definition and meaning for predate

PREDATE

  • (verb) establish something as being earlier relative to something else

    synonyms : antedate , foredate

  • (verb) prey on or hunt for

    "These mammals predate certain eggs"

    synonyms : prey , raven

    Vultures are known to prey on human flesh. -added by naila_inlas

  • (verb) come before

    "Most English adjectives precede the noun they modify"

    synonyms : precede

  • (verb) be earlier in time; go back further

    "Stone tools precede bronze tools"

    synonyms : antecede , antedate , forego , forgo , precede
